Video Summary
Cardio is the dominating exercise choice for weight loss. And for a very very long time, it was believed that doing long, steady-state cardio would be the best option, thus leading to half the gym floors filled with an abundance of cardio equipment. Although cardio very much can be effective for weight loss, it it becoming increasingly clear that cardio alone is not the most efficient way to lose weight. Instead, a bit of resistance training can go a long way, all the while keeping your exercise hours the same. And a new study can help us understand this a bit further.
